Vat of Kirbuster. The vat is a "gloup" - a partially collapsed sea cave with part of the roof remaining and forming an arch. (The name is sometimes spelt Kirbister. The SNH sign at the nearby car park has both spellings.)

Best time to go to Stronsay

The best time to visit Stronsay can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Stronsay falls in August,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Stronsay falls in February,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January43.7°F (6.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
February43.2°F (6.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.7°F (6.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May48.0°F (8.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
June52.0°F (11.1°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
July55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August56.1°F (13.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
September54.7°F (12.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
October51.6°F (10.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November48.4°F (9.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low

What is the best area to stay in Stronsay?
The best area to stay in Stronsay is around the village of Whitehall, which is the island's main settlement.

Whitehall is centrally located on the island and offers the most amenities. You'll find the island's main shop, post office, and the Stronsay Hotel, which serves meals and drinks. The harbor area is a focal point, with views of the bay and nearby islands. It's a convenient base for exploring the rest of Stronsay.

Couples looking for a quiet retreat will appreciate Whitehall's peaceful setting. It provides a comfortable base with essential services, allowing for relaxed walks along the coast or visits to the island's natural attractions without needing to travel far for supplies.

For solo travelers, staying in Whitehall offers a sense of community and ease of access to local information.
When is the best time to go to Stronsay?
The best time to visit Stronsay is typically between late spring and early autumn, from May to September, for the most favorable weather conditions.

During these months, you'll experience milder temperatures and longer daylight hours, making it ideal for exploring the island's natural beauty. This period is particularly good for outdoor activities like coastal walks, wildlife spotting, and enjoying the island's beaches. May and September offer a quieter experience with pleasant weather, while July and August are the warmest months and popular for summer holidays.

Travelers interested in birdwatching will find May and June particularly rewarding, as many migratory bird species are present on the island during this time. The cliffs and coastal areas become bustling with nesting seabirds, offering excellent viewing opportunities.

For those looking to experience local events, late July and early August often feature community gatherings and traditional activities, providing a glimpse into island life.
